Operation Liberty (The Last Hunter Book 10) Kindle Edition
Admiral Jack Romanoff and his crew have defeated the Locusts once and for all, but they are far from the only invaders infesting the Confederation. The time to go after the xenophobic Novarites and free those worlds has come, and nothing will stand in his way.
If words aren’t enough, show them your teeth and bite deep.
There are times in war when quarter is neither asked for nor given. The only thing that can slake the combatants’ thirst is their enemy’s lifeblood. Then it’s war to the knife that doesn’t end until one side is dead.
That time has now come, and humanity’s enemies must bleed.

#1 Bestselling Military Science Fiction author Terry Mixon served as a non-commissioned officer in the United States Army 101st Airborne Division. He later worked alongside the flight controllers in the Mission Control Center at the NASA Johnson Space Center supporting the Space Shuttle, the International Space Station, and other human spaceflight projects.
He now writes full time while living in Texas with his lovely wife and a pounce of cats. Visit terrymixon.com to learn more.

- Reviewed in the United States on August 28, 2023Another good installment in the 'Last Hunter' series. Admiral Jack Romanoff is making progress, securing the local systems, putting things back into a semblance of order after the initial alien invasion. The bigger issues of the coup d'état within the Confederacy remains to be addressed another day. The development within this series is interesting; most books in this genre would have Romanoff front and center as the main character from the first chapter of first book going forward with everyone else off to the side in support roles . In the 'Last Hunter' that has been changing as there is a core group around Romanoff that has now taken center stage, leaving him more and more off to the side as they start to carry more and more of the story forward. Lisa Gain has become a pivotal character and much of this book revolves around her and her transition from her initial status as a criminal hacker, to trusted computer security specialist, and now moving into the world of intelligence operations. The same pattern holds true for the other main side characters, all gradually growing in position and influence. This is a smart way to move the story line forward and makes for a very interesting method of character development and as well as plot advancement. Highly recommend this series by Chaney and Mixon, one of the very best currently out there.
